Hello, if your cervix is low and soft what does that mean? Thanks in advance x

Not sure - it should be high and open when you're ovulating. What I would say is that the cervix is quite a tricky thing to judge for some people (definitely for me) so it might be worth tracking ovulation in a different way (if that's what you're using it for). Also, I am not sure it's a good idea to poke at it too much as it can introduce outside bacteria.

@Suzanne4989 usually it goes low after ov or before af
Mine was high and hard which doesn't appear to be a combination people talk about either but it's different for every one so only really reliable if your tracked for months and know your norm. It's good if you know yours to detect ov but it's not reliable at detecting pregnancy as although it rises some peoples don't rise until 12 weeks
